The Antigua Public Utilities Authority (APUA) Electricity Business Unit sincerely apologizes to customers served by the Five Islands #4 circuit for the extended outage experienced on Friday 28 February 2025.
Initially, maintenance work was expected to take approximately 90 minutes.
However, during the exercise, our technicians identified additional issues that could potentially cause future outages. To enhance service reliability, the team took immediate action to address these concerns.
Due to the specific location of the circuit, it could not be connected to an alternate power source, resulting in a prolonged outage from 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.
The impacted areas included Union Road, Five Islands, Hatton, Grays Farm, Green Bay, Cooks Hill.
We appreciate your patience and understanding as we continue working to provide safe and reliable electricity service.
